谷歌浏览器插件
订阅小程序
在清言上使用

BWEFoam: An open-source Boussinesq types of equations solver based on OpenFOAM

Fangrui Liu,Huai Zhang,Yaolin Shi

SoftwareX(2024)

引用 0|浏览1
暂无评分
摘要
Boussinesq-type wave models improve traditional shallow water models by incorporating higher-order terms that account for dispersion effects during wave propagation. Essentially, they are applicable when the wave number times water depth (kd) does not satisfy the shallow water condition (kd<<1). BWEFoam, introduced in this work, is implemented in the finite-volume-method based OpenFOAM framework. The high-order Boussinesq-type equations are employed as the governing equations to incorporate the effect of dispersion. The effects of bottom friction and momentum diffusion are also integrated as source terms. Validation against a dam break scenario confirms its accuracy compared to analytical solutions while its ability to capture dispersion effects is demonstrated in a solitary wave propagation simulation. BWEFoam broadens the scope of water wave simulations, offering improved relevance in realistic scenarios where the dispersion effect cannot be neglected.
更多
查看译文
关键词
Boussinesq-type wave equations,Computational fluid dynamics,OpenFOAM,Numerical simulations
AI 理解论文
溯源树
样例
生成溯源树,研究论文发展脉络
Chat Paper
正在生成论文摘要